🚀 Getting Started with Ledger Live
When you first launch Ledger Live, you’ll land on the welcome screen. Click “Get Started”, then select your device—Nano S, Nano X, etc.—and choose whether to set up a new wallet or restore using a recovery phrase . From there, you can install app support for Bitcoin, Ethereum, and more via the Manager.
🔐 Logging In: What “Login” Means
Ledger Live doesn’t ask for a username/password like most apps. Instead, you unlock your wallet by connecting and verifying your Ledger hardware device. Optionally, under Settings → General, enable a password lock—so any time you open the app, you must enter that password to view portfolio balances .
✅ Logging Out or Resetting
Curious about how to logout? Reddit users confirm there’s no classic "Sign out" button:
“I was able to ‘log out’ by resetting the application in settings.”
You can find this under Settings → Help → Reset Ledger Live—this wipes all local data (accounts, history, settings), effectively logging you out. Alternatively, uninstalling and reinstalling the app also clears everything .
